Naruli

Naruli is a village in the Palghar district of Maharashtra, India. It is located in the Dahanu taluka.

Demographics

According to the 2011 census of India, Naruli has 263 households. The effective literacy rate (i.e. the literacy rate of population excluding children aged 6 and below) is 27.17%.

Demographics (2011 Census)
Total Male Female
Population 1398 643 755
Children aged below 6 years 338 152 186
Scheduled caste 0 0 0
Scheduled tribe 1392 638 754
Literates 288 184 104
Workers (all) 745 348 397
Main workers (total) 527 289 238
Main workers: Cultivators 409 212 197
Main workers: Agricultural labourers 75 41 34
Main workers: Household industry workers 0 0 0
Main workers: Other 43 36 7
Marginal workers (total) 218 59 159
Marginal workers: Cultivators 107 26 81
Marginal workers: Agricultural labourers 86 19 67
Marginal workers: Household industry workers 4 3 1
Marginal workers: Others 21 11 10
Non-workers 653 295 358
